软件工程学
学校: 无
问题 1: 1. 软件生存周期中花费时间最长成本最多的阶段是( )。
选项:
• A. 详细设计
• B. 软件编码
• C. 软件测试
• D. 软件维护
答案: 软件维护
问题 2: 2. 软件工程的三要素不包括( )。
选项:
• A. 工具
• B. 过程
• C. 方法
• D. 环境
答案: 环境
问题 3: 3. 具有风险控制、客户评审的模型是( )
选项:
• A. 瀑布模型
• B. 增量模型
• C. 原型模型
• D. 螺旋模型
答案: 螺旋模型
问题 4: 4. 瀑布模型突出的缺点是不适应( )的变动。
选项:
• A. 算法
• B. 程序语言
• C. 平台
• D. 用户需求
答案: 用户需求
问题 5: 5. 在软件开发模型中,提出最早、最基础的模型是( )。
选项:
• A. 瀑布模型
• B. 喷泉模型
• C. 快速原型模型
• D. 螺旋模型
答案: 瀑布模型
问题 6: 6. 瀑布模型不适合用于( )的软件开发。
选项:
• A. 需求模糊不清
• B. 用户不能参与开发
• C. 用户对计算机不了解
• D. 开发人员对业务知识不熟悉
答案: 需求模糊不清
问题 7: 7. 快速原型的主要优点不包括( )。
选项:
• A. 能让用户参与开发、给出反馈
• B. 尽早把需求分析清楚,以降低风险
• C. 尽早地发现问题、纠正错误
• D. 对软件分析设计人员的素质要求不高
答案: 请关注公众号【渝粤搜题】查看答案
问题 8: 8. 快速原型的主要问题在于( )。
选项:
• A. 缺乏支持原型开发的工具
• B. 要严格控制原型构造的迭代
• C. 终端用户对原型不能理解
• D. 软件的测试和文档更新困难
答案: 请关注公众号【渝粤搜题】查看答案
问题 9: 9. 螺旋模型是一种将瀑布模型和( )结合起来的软件开发模型。
选项:
• A. 增量模型
• B. 专家系统
• C. 喷泉模型
• D. 变换模型
答案: 请关注公众号【渝粤搜题】查看答案
问题 10: 10. 在软件生产的程序系统时代由于软件规模扩大和和软件复杂性提高等原因导致了( )。
选项:
• A. 软件危机
• B. 软件工程
• C. 程序设计革命
• D. 结构化程序设计
答案: 请关注公众号【渝粤搜题】查看答案
问题 11: 11. 软件开发方法是( )。
选项:
• A. 指导软件开发的一系列规则和约定
• B. 软件开发的步骤
• C. 软件开发的技术
• D. 软件开发的思想
答案: 请关注公众号【渝粤搜题】查看答案
问题 12: 12. 快速原型模型对软件开发人员的水平要求不高。
选项:
答案: 请关注公众号【渝粤搜题】查看答案
问题 13: 13. 软件开发过程中,一个错误发现得越晚,为改正它所付出的代价就越大。
选项:
答案: 请关注公众号【渝粤搜题】查看答案
问题 14: 14. 原型是软件的一个早期可运行的版本,它反映最终系统的部分重要特性。
选项:
答案: 请关注公众号【渝粤搜题】查看答案
问题 15: 15. 软件同其它事物一样,有孕育、诞生、成长、成熟和衰亡的生存过程。
选项:
答案: 请关注公众号【渝粤搜题】查看答案
问题 16: 16. 软件危机的产生主要是因为程序设计人员使用了不适当的程序设计语言。
选项:
答案: 请关注公众号【渝粤搜题】查看答案
问题 17: 17. 软件在运行和使用中也存在退化问题。
选项:
答案: 请关注公众号【渝粤搜题】查看答案
问题 18: 18. 软件的维护与硬件维护本质上是相同的。
选项:
答案: 请关注公众号【渝粤搜题】查看答案
问题 19: 19. 喷泉模型适合于面向对象的软件开发。
选项:
答案: 请关注公众号【渝粤搜题】查看答案
问题 20: 20. 面向对象开发方法的主要缺点是在适应需求变化方面不够灵活。
选项:
答案: 请关注公众号【渝粤搜题】查看答案
微信扫码添加好友
如二维码无法识别,可拨打 13662661040 咨询。